1. About Habitação, Construção e Desenvolvimento Law in Burgau, Portugal
Habitação, Construção e Desenvolvimento law in Burgau combines national codes with local urban planning rules. The framework covers buying, selling, leasing, renovating and building homes, as well as the permitting and supervision of construction works. In Burgau, as part of the Algarve, you are subject to municipal planning instruments alongside national regimes for urbanization and building.
The Regime Jurídico da Urbanização e Edificação (RJUE) governs how properties may be urbanized and how works are licensed in Portugal, including Burgau. This regime sets the baseline for project approvals, architectural controls and compliance with safety standards. Local planning tools, such as the Plano Director Municipal (PDM), translate RJUE requirements into Burgau specific rules.
RJUE provides the overarching licensing regime for urban projects across Portugal, including Burgau.
Beyond licensing, housing matters involve leases, property registrations and energy performance considerations. The Lei do Arrendamento Urbano (LAU) covers landlord and tenant rights and obligations that affect rental properties in Burgau. Municipal inspections, registries and energy certificates are commonly required during property transactions or renovations. 3. Local Laws Overview
Two to three core legal regimes influence Habitação, Construção e Desenvolvimento in Burgau, alongside the administrative processes used to obtain approvals:
- Regime Jurídico da Urbanização e Edificação (RJUE) - This regime governs the licensing of urbanization and building works in Portugal, including procedures and documentation required for construction projects in Burgau. It provides the baseline for municipal licensing decisions and compliance checks.
- Lei do Arrendamento Urbano (LAU) - This law regulates leasing of urban properties, affecting rental negotiations, deposits, term lengths and tenant protections that property owners and investors in Burgau must follow.
- Código do Procedimento Administrativo - The Administrative Procedure Code governs administrative steps, deadlines and appeals for licensing and related municipal actions. Updates in recent years aim to streamline processes and expand online submissions.

4. Frequently Asked Questions
What is RJUE and how does it affect building permits in Burgau?
RJUE is the overarching regime for urbanization and building works in Portugal. It sets the documentary and engineering standards required for a permit, and the municipal council applies it to Burgau projects. Your permit process will hinge on how your plans comply with RJUE requirements.
How do I apply for a building license in Burgau?
Submit a project dossier through the local Câmara Municipal with architectural and engineering designs, a location plan and environmental considerations. The council reviews documentation and may request clarifications before granting a license. A lawyer can help package and track the submission.
When can I start construction after obtaining a permit in Burgau?
Construction may start after license approval and the mandatory formalities are met. You may face conditions that must be satisfied before commencement. Delays can occur if the council issues observations or requires additional documentation.
Where should I file my licensing application for Burgau projects?
Applications are filed with the local Câmara Municipal that governs Burgau, typically within Vila do Bispo or the relevant municipal office handling urban planning. They will provide forms, deadlines and submission guidance. You should confirm the exact office location and submission method with the local council.
Why might a permit application be delayed in Burgau?
Delays often occur due to missing documents, need for environmental or heritage assessments, or conflicting zoning rules in the PDM. Municipal teams may also request clarifications or additional expert reports. Timely responses from your legal counsel can minimize turnaround times.
How much does a building license cost in Burgau?
Costs vary by project type, size and the council's fee schedule. Typical costs include processing fees, technical reports and possible consulting fees for architects or engineers. Your lawyer can provide a precise estimate after reviewing your project scope.
Do I need an energy performance certificate for a new build in Burgau?
Yes. Energy performance certificates are generally required for new builds and significant renovations. The certificate informs energy efficiency standards and can affect sale or lease transactions. Your architect or engineer can arrange this as part of the licensing package.
Should I hire a Habitação Construção e Desenvolvimento lawyer for a property purchase in Burgau?
Yes. A local lawyer helps verify title, licenses, and compliance with RJUE and LAU. They can also spot encumbrances, servitudes, or irregularities that could affect value or use. This reduces risk when buying in Burgau.
Can I appeal a licensing decision by the Câmara Municipal?
Yes. You can typically appeal within defined deadlines to the appropriate administrative court or appeal body. A lawyer can structure the appeal and assemble the necessary evidence, including expert reports. Timely action is important for preserving your rights.
Is there a fast-track permit procedure for minor works in Burgau?
Portugal has programs to streamline certain minor works, subject to local council rules. Burgau may offer simplified pathways for small renovations if criteria are met. A local solicitor or architect can confirm eligibility and timelines for your project.
What is the difference between final reception and provisional reception of works?
The provisional reception confirms that the completed works satisfy most conditions and are usable in part. The final reception certifies full compliance with the licensing terms and safety requirements. Both are critical for occupancy and property transfer.
Do I need a pre-consultation with the local council before starting?
A pre-consultation helps identify potential issues before formal submissions. It can reveal zoning conflicts, environmental constraints or required reports. Engaging early with Burgau's municipal office through your legal counsel can save time later.
